Fantastic. Key for nomads and politics. Do, do start here, and not with, for instance, the more famous Khazanov. One has to take sides on these matters: Salzman gives you quite a different interpretation, and me, I was glad to have Khazanov disproved. Salzman's interest is in the political freedom very often valued in nomad societies. So if your heart throbs to slogans of Liberty, Equality...
As an additional, it's simple to read. That is no bad thing in social theory, if you ask me.
